Gigabyte GA-78LMT-S2P - CPU upgrades?

My best guess would be the FX-8120. It will give you a 2000 point boost over the FX-4100 according to CPUBenchmark.net
 
Do NOT get 8120 or 8140. Do not get anything x1xx. You want x3xx, which is the Piledriver revision of Bulldozer. It uses the same or less power and is significantly faster. I checked in on your motherboard and it will support all the new Piledriver chips, 8320 + 8350 included (anything x3xx). You must have the latest BIOS on your motherboard for it to work however. So update the BIOS before you install the new CPU. Given that you are using 760g chipset I wouldn't expect much/any overclocking headroom on the chip you get but moving up to a 6300 or greater will be a nice improvement from the Piledriver architecture plus the extra cores.

What are you talking about?

83xx and 63xx processors are widely available, there is literally no reason at all to get the 81xx or 61xx unless they are vastly cheaper and you're on a tight budget.

OP: Your motherboard can't handle the 8320 or 8350 so I would recommend just getting the 6300. You move up to 3 modules, 6 threads ("6 core") which will help since Planetside 2 just got the update that adds better multi-core usage in the game. http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16819113286
